The categories of information that we gather about you includes:
(a) Personal Information: This encompasses a variety of data you provide such as your name, gender, address, telephone number, email address, username, profession, password, date of birth, payment and credit card particulars, bank account information, purchase history, feedback, IP details and geographical location, digital device identity and specifications, information regarding your downloading of Publications including timings, interruptions, and outcome of such actions, the web address through which you reached the Sites, demographic data, views, registration or profile details shared through integrated services like social media platforms upon your approval, search your contacts with your permission, and other similar information related to the aforementioned that has been furnished to the Company; as well as any information the Company receives pursuant to these categories for the purpose of collection, reception, possession, utilization, processing, recording, storage, sharing, handling, and disclosure under a legitimate contract or otherwise. All such data is collectively recognized as "Personal Information".

(b) Aggregate Information: During your interactions with our Sites, we may collect broader information that does not personally identify you. This consists of data such as your IP address, duration of website or mobile app visit, browsing patterns, and similar 'Aggregate Information'. This Policy is not extended to information that you decide to make public or data that is openly accessible in the public domain, or information provided under the Right to Information Act, 2005, or any other prevailing laws. Such publicly disclosed information will not be considered as Personal Information under this Policy.

We may reach out to you with potentially beneficial information regarding products and services through our telemarketing activities. Should you prefer not to receive our telemarketing communications, we invite you to register this preference with our call centre by providing the details of the telephone number you wish to exclude. Nevertheless, we retain the right to contact you via telephonic communication regarding services pertaining to your account. Moreover, we pledge to comply with the prevailing laws related to telemarketing and adhere to guidelines set forth by regulatory authorities, such as TRAI's Do Not Disturb ("DND") policy or equivalent regulations. Upon your registration for any such DND service, we will remove your telephone number(s) from our telemarketing lists within 30 working days, ensuring that you no longer receive unsolicited telemarketing calls.

Cookies: On our Website, we employ cookies or similar tracking technologies. These cookies are small data files placed on your web browser to track your navigational activities on our site, compile analytics, identify usage patterns, and to oversee the Website's utility. They are designed for your user convenience and to help us manage an effective service. By agreeing to these Terms, you give your consent for our use of cookies and comparable technologies for the stated purposes.
